Research Field
The Quantum Networks Group develops novel hardware for distributed quantum information processing. In particular, erbium dopants in nanophotonic silicon chips are used to generate entanglement between remote quantum systems. The goal of this research is to develop a Quantum Internet in which quantum computers and quantum sensors can be safely connected.
